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.08.04;
Скачать: CL | DM;

Вниз

взять перейти в DataSet   Найти похожие ветки 

 
cjiohobaji ©   (2003-07-15 13:27) [0]

Смотрю этот англоязычный хэлп и ничего не понимаю. Скажите пожалуяста три или больше функции: Вывести текущее значение ячейки (источник данных TTable), двигаться вбок по строке, двигаться вверх вниз по столбцу.


 
NickBat ©   (2003-07-15 13:30) [1]

> двигаться вбок по строке
а это как?
Есть записи, есть поля в таблице. По какой строке идете, товарищ? :))


 
cjiohobaji ©   (2003-07-15 13:36) [2]

двигаться по записи , т. е. выводить ячейки записи
п
номер | имя
1 вася
2 петя
Как вывести на экран(присвоить в переменную) "петя"?
Как получить доступ к пете программно.




 
Zacho ©   (2003-07-15 13:40) [3]


> cjiohobaji © (15.07.03 13:27)

Почитай наконец книжки !
И теперь пара подсказок:
В TDataSet есть текущая запись (строка), никакой текущей ячейки нет. Есть поля в строке, см. TDataSet.Fields, TDataSet.FieldByName, TField и т.п.
Для навигации по записям есть методы TDataSet.First, TDataSet.Last, TDataSet.Next и т.д.


 
Skier ©   (2003-07-15 13:41) [4]

>cjiohobaji © (15.07.03 13:27)
Не кури такую траву !


 
Digitman ©   (2003-07-15 13:52) [5]


> cjiohobaji


нет в таблице понятия "ячейка".
есть записи и поля записей
есть также осн.понятие - текущая запись
перемещение по записям (т.е. установка тек.записи) - First, Last, Prior, Next, MoveBy и т.д.
получение значения поля тек.записи - Fields[номер поля], FieldByName("имя поля") и т.д.


 
cjiohobaji ©   (2003-07-15 13:54) [6]

БОльшое спасибо. На книжки денег нету, вот хожу по форумам,


 
Жук ©   (2003-07-15 13:55) [7]

Модераторы ! Да пристрелите вы его, плз, шоб не мучился.


 
Zacho ©   (2003-07-15 14:02) [8]


> cjiohobaji © (15.07.03 13:54)

И ты думаешь, что хождением по форумам научишься программировать ? Напрасно.
И вообще, странно: на книжки денег нет, а на интернет есть.


 
cjiohobaji ©   (2003-07-16 07:01) [9]

>zacho

Да хождением по форуму я узнаю то чего, не смог найти в других местах, добрые люди помогли, а некоторые только и брюзжат, охохо он знает меньше чем мы. Тьфу


 
Digitman ©   (2003-07-16 09:13) [10]


> cjiohobaji


замечания тебе верно делают ! вопрос твой построен весьма коряво и отражает явное невладение терминологией и непонимание сущности.

изволь объяснить


> Вывести текущее значение ячейки


что значит "вывести" ? куда "вывести" ?


> двигаться вбок по строке, двигаться вверх вниз по столбцу.


что значит "вбок" ? где у набора данных есть "бок", "верх", "низ" ? что означает "двигаться" ?
ведь набор данных (НД) - невизуальное понятие !!


 
Zacho ©   (2003-07-16 11:16) [11]


> cjiohobaji © (16.07.03 07:01)

Дело не в том, меньше ты знаешь или больше, а в том, что получать базовые знания путем "хождения по форумам" крайне не эффективно. Убьешь кучу времени, и скорее всего так и останешься недоучкой, нахватавшимся разрозненных кусочков знаний. Для получения базовых знаний (а именно их тебе сейчас и не хватает) лучше всего - хорошая книга, а форумы предназначены несколько для другого.
Не обижайся и не плюйся, а лучше сам хорошо подумай.


 
MsGuns ©   (2003-07-16 12:10) [12]

А что, у него F1 не фунциклюет ?


 
cjiohobaji ©   (2003-07-17 06:27) [13]

>Zacho

Насчёт базовых понятий согласен, надо было и вправду что-нибудь систематизированное почитать,

Я похоже был неправ.
Всем спасибо.




Страницы: 1 вся ветка

Текущий архив: 2003.08.04;
Скачать: CL | DM;

Наверх




Память: 0.49 MB
Время: 0.014 c
6-10342
AndrewK
2003-05-27 14:45
2003.08.04
Как можно организовать оповещение на другую машину?


7-10487
yurikon
2003-05-23 09:11
2003.08.04
Ошибка Win2000


3-10099
N&N
2003-07-14 11:09
2003.08.04
Как присвоить полю Integer значение


3-10118
Котяра
2003-07-14 19:26
2003.08.04
Как быстрее вычислить поле?


4-10497
Flex
2003-05-31 14:54
2003.08.04
/ Помогите понять Msg.Result:=1 /